MY FIRST VISIT TO BULGARIA!

We landed at Sofia airport at 3am local Bulgarian time. I had organised to stay for the remainder of the night at the Brod hotel in central Sofia near the airport. A young man arrived in his car to pick us up for the short journey to the hotel. The Brod hotel gave us a very clean and comfortable nights sleep. In the morning we enjoyed breakfast and some well needed coffee as we awaited the car we had chosen to rent through the internet from the UK. The car rental company I chose was Sikon Group. At the arranged time, two guys from Sikon car rental arrived with my hire car, a little 1.2 purple Corsa.
I paid them the £100 deposit and the car rental charge was just 18 euros per day inclusive!
We headed out of Sofia and onto the motorway towards Plovdiv. The scenery was pretty flat until we got nearer to Plovdiv and it started to change into hills on the right and flat plain on the left.
We passed by Plovdiv and took the road to Asenovgrad. This road was pitted with pot holes! The other drivers in front appeared to be driving drunk as they slowly swerved around the road in order to avoid the very deep holes! No one drove mad.
We stopped about half way through the road from Asenovgrad to Kardjali at a place high in the mountains with a fresh spring of drinking water flowing and very beautiful scenic area where they had placed some garden table and chairs for tourists and locals to enjoy the very scenic view over the hills and forests!
We took the rest of the journey into Kardjali with caution of the many potholes in the road. Along the way were many animals walking about enjoying the scenery!

We were welcomed into Kardjali by Martin a Bulgarian property agent and shown to a very cosy hotel with spectacular view over one of the lakes of the Kardjali region.
The Zarazen hotel was warm and welcoming and the Bulgarian food cooked there delicious! All the vegetables grown in the Bulgarian fertile soil, even the carrots tasted very different and extremely tasty.
Most nights we ate different variations of chicken, and each chicken meal was full of taste and soft like butter. From Kardjali it is not far to the Greek border, although there are still Bulgarian border patrols stopping you to ask where you are going and they only speak Bulgarian. Luckily for us we were with Dimo a Bulgarian property estate agent or I'm unsure as to whether or not we could have passed! Aparently the Greek border pass is soon to be fully open making the Kardjali region a lovely place to stay for a very relaxing holiday in a totally unspoilt land.
The centre of Kardjali was filled with old high rise blocks of apartments and of the Bulgarians who lived there for the work available. The countryside was full of abandoned derelect houses and forests of pine trees.
There are many houses for sale now in Bulgaria. The houses are very run down and a lot of them are made of mud bricks, the large gardens contain the outside loo with natural seep away septic tanks and running water is usually available in the garden but not in the house itself. Although the houses for sale are very inexpensive, a lot of work would be involved in renovating an old house there and as Bulgaria is in the midst of being renewed, most of the work force there are now busy with house and business projects.

SHOPPING in BULGARIA
There are many markets in the villages of Bulgaria. Apart from the well stocked markets, there are also frequent delivery vans, delivering to your doorstep a variety of foods, vegetables, pots n pans etc! The markets offer extremely cheap purchases, so if you're looking to go shopping while in Bulgaria, the markets your oyster!
The main market square in the old part of Kardjali, is currently being revamped to have a spectacular roof offering the new under cover market! I have photos of the market place under construction and will continue to take photos as the development develops!
The supermarkets all stock a wide variety of food stuffs, although some is obviously unrecognisable by us, the foods offered are cheap and some English style foods are available even in the smaller more remote villages! You won't go hungry!


ARCHAEOLOGY in BULGARIA
Bulgaria is full of archaeological sites now being rediscovered by teams of archaeologists from all over. The important holy temple at Perperikon is one such archaeological digs site we have visited. We intend to visit as many archaeological sites as we can, we did visit the Tomb of Tatul, photos coming soon. When we arrived at the archaeological site of Perperikon, there was a camera crew and many working on the new digs, new finds of ancient jewellery and other artifacts.
To visit the site of Perperikon, attempt the climb in the cool of the day, or off season as it is a strenuous climb up to the top of the hill that is the ancient temple site of Perperikon.
